Meva Energy - Combined Heat and Power (CHP) System

Wood derived residues have been proven to work well in Meva Energy's gasification technology. Also engineered wood residues, such as dust from MDF and chipboard processing, which is contaminated with glue. The fine fraction glue contaminated furniture production waste is often  difficule to recycle. It is often disregarded as a source of energy as it would result in enhanced emissions. Due to the low levels of oxygen in Meva Energys gasification technology, the nitrogen oxides can be kept very low and convert the solid nitrogen in to harmless nitrogen gas.

Meva Energy - Renewable Gas Producing Plant

Meva Energy´s renewable gas producing plant will be replacing fossil gas consumption at Sofidel’s tissue mill in Kisa, Sweden. Switching to renewable Meva gas, it is estimated that the mill will reduce its CO2 emissions by 8,500 tons per year compared with the carbon footprint of today’s consumption of fossil LPG. By utilizing the generated biochar, a total of 10,300 tons of Co2 can be reduced. The fossil fuel free new plant is schedule to start up in the second quarter of 2023 with fuel locally produced out of wooden pellets.

Meva Energy - Gasification Unit

Meva Energy will start build a gasification unit at IKEA industry's furniture production unit in Poland. By using IKEA's residues generated from their furniture production, we can transform it into renewable power and heat which will be supplied back to the factory. This will create a circular energy system for the production site. Taking care of the low value residues of the production will reduce costs and also the CO2 impact, up to 20,000 tons per year.
